Highlights

On average, there are 199 sunny days per year in Albertville. Brooklyn averages 226 sunny days per year. The US average is 205 sunny days.

Albertville, Alabama gets 54.7 inches of rain, on average, per year. Brooklyn, New York gets 46.1 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38.1 inches of rain per year.

Albertville averages 1.3 inches of snow per year. Brooklyn averages 24.9 inches of snow per year. The US average is 27.8 inches of snow per year.

July is the hottest month for Brooklyn with an average high temperature of 84.3°, which ranks it as one of the hottest places in New York. In Brooklyn, there are 5 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Brooklyn are June, September and August.

July is the hottest month for Albertville with an average high temperature of 88.0°, which ranks it as one of the coolest places in Alabama. In Albertville, there are 5 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Albertville are May, September and October.
January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Brooklyn with an average of 26.5°. This is one of the warmest places in New York.

January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Albertville with an average of 30.5°. This is colder than most places in Alabama.

In Brooklyn, there are 13.1 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is one of the hottest places in New York.

In Albertville, there are 28.3 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is one of the coolest places in Alabama.

In Brooklyn, there are 68.2 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is one of the warmest places in New York.

In Albertville, there are 57.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is about average compared to other places in Alabama.

In Brooklyn,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is one of the warmest places in New York.

In Albertville, there are 0.1 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is colder than most places in Alabama.

July is the wettest month in Brooklyn with 4.6 inches of rain, and the driest month is February with 2.8 inches. The wettest season is Autumn with 28% of yearly precipitation and 21% occurs in Spring,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 46.1 inches in Brooklyn means that it is about average compared to other places in New York.


February is the wettest month in Albertville with 5.2 inches of rain, and the driest month is October with 3.5 inches. The wettest season is Spring with 28% of yearly precipitation and 22% occurs in Winter,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 54.7 inches in Albertville means that it is drier than most places in Alabama.

April is the rainiest month in Brooklyn with 11.2 days of rain, and September is the driest month with only 8.3 rainy days. There are 118.4 rainy days annually in Brooklyn, which is less rainy than most places in New York. The rainiest season is Summer when it rains 28% of the time and the driest is Winter with only a 22% chance of a rainy day.

December is the rainiest month in Albertville with 9.8 days of rain, and October is the driest month with only 6.4 rainy days. There are 106.5 rainy days annually in Albertville, which is about average compared to other places in Alabama.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 27% of the time and the driest is Winter with only a 20% chance of a rainy day.

An annual snowfall of 24.9 inches in Brooklyn means that it is less snowy than most places in New York.

An annual snowfall of 1.3 inches in Albertville means that it is snowier than most places in Alabama.
February is the snowiest month in Brooklyn with 8.4 inches of snow, and 5 months of the year have significant snowfall.

March is the snowiest month in Albertville with 0.5 inches of snow, and 2 months of the year have significant snowfall.

DID YOU KNOW?

Many people confuse Weather and Climate, but they are different. Weather ref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, while Climate ref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a long period of time.

Weather, more specifically, refers to how the atmosphere behaves and its effects on life and human activities. Most people think of Weather in terms of what can be observed: temperature, humidity, precipitation, and cloudy/sunny conditions. Weather conditions constantly change on a minute-to-minute basis.

Climate is a record of the average weather conditions for a given place over a long period of time, often referred to as Climate Normals. A 30-year period of record is a common requirement to be considered a Climate Normal.
